Y主键约束用来强制数据的"实体"完整性。
在关系数据库中,实体完整性是指表中每一行数据都应该有一个唯一的标识。这个标识可以通过主键约束来实现。主键约束强制表中的某个列或列组合成为主键,并且保证该列或列组合中的每个值都是唯一的,即不存在重复的值。因此,主键约束可以用于实现实体完整性。因此,答案是B:“实体”。域完整性是指对表中某个列的取值进行限制,参照完整性是指确保在关系数据库中引用其他表的数据时,引用的数据是存在的。ABC选项都不正确。
